Transaction 93f7938caebf49afc44add26ccd69c4a4f63c338fc2fb0ce1f5faa410dfb8ec3
1 Input
1 Outputs
- 93f7938caebf49afc44add26ccd69c4a4f63c338fc2fb0ce1f5faa410dfb8ec3:0
value 50990131
address 1JeNvVgN63t81kxpbFvNa9o6sBpazjyg4r